Revisiting "Swades" (2004): A Journey of Self-Discovery and Patriotism

Released in 2004, "Swades" is a film that struck a chord with audiences worldwide for its profound narrative, exceptional cinematography, and Aamir Khan's compelling performance. "Swades" explores several meaningful themes such as patriotism, self-discovery, social responsibility, and the impact one individual can have on a community. The film encourages viewers to think about their contribution to society and the importance of giving back to one's community. Aamir Khan's performance was widely praised for its nuance and the way he portrayed Mohan's journey from alienation to a sense of belonging and purpose. The movie tells the story of Mohan Bhargava (played by Aamir Khan), a skilled engineer working at NASA, who, despite having a successful career and a comfortable life in the United States, feels a deep sense of disconnection and emptiness. His life takes a turn when he learns that his grandmother has passed away in his ancestral village in India. Attending her funeral, Mohan gets a chance to reconnect with his roots and meets a spirited young woman named Kiran (played by Gayatri Joshi), who works as a school teacher with a rural community.
